If you end up with a C, it's not necessarily the end of the world. If you get anything below a C, I would definitely retake. Personally, I think whether to retake a C is somewhat negotiable. It depends on the quality of the rest of your app. (Is your GPA otherwise strong? Do you have C's in any other prereqs? I don't think one C won't kill you but several certainly can. If you have other academic weak spots, a retake might be more important for you.)
I've never heard of adcoms looking at any one grade first and I think that's pretty unlikely. It's more about the whole package than it is about any one course.
